El corte original de Star Wars, George Lucas, no quería que vieras en Londres

¿Crees que has visto el clásico "Star Wars" de 1977? Piense de nuevo. Lo que probablemente ha experimentado es una de las diversas versiones alteradas lanzadas después de su carrera teatral original, ajustada por el propio George Lucas en lo que se conocería como las "ediciones especiales" de esta querida epopeya. Sin embargo, hay una nueva esperanza en el horizonte: los fanáticos pronto tendrán la oportunidad de ver el corte original e intacto de la película que Lucas dejó hace décadas.

Este junio, el Festival de Cine del British Film Institute en el Festival de Cine comenzará con una rara proyección de una de las pocas impresiones tecnicolor restantes de la carrera inicial de "Star Wars". Según el Telegraph, esto marca la primera muestra pública de esta impresión desde diciembre de 1978, aunque ha estado disponible en VHS en el pasado.

George Lucas comenzó a alterar la película con su primer relanzamiento teatral en 1981, y desde entonces, Lucasfilm solo ha permitido proyecciones de varias "ediciones especiales". La impresión que se mostrará en el próximo festival es particularmente emocionante para los fanáticos; Se ha conservado meticulosamente a 23 grados Fahrenheit durante los últimos cuarenta años, prometiendo una experiencia de visualización casi sin flujo.

Históricamente, Lucas ha sido firme en su decisión contra la detección del corte original de lo que ahora se conoce como "Episodio IV: A New Hope", y ha discutido abiertamente esta postura a lo largo de los años. En una entrevista de 2004 con Associated Press, dijo: "La edición especial, esa es la que quería. La otra película, está en VHS, si alguien lo quiere. No voy a gastar el-Estamos hablando de millones de dólares aquí: el dinero y el tiempo para reacondicionar que, para mí, ya no existe. Es como quiero que sea.

No está claro qué ha provocado el aparente cambio de opinión de Lucas con respecto a esta proyección, pero los fanáticos ciertamente no se quejan de la oportunidad de ver la versión original de esta película icónica.
